(e)
(1) The term "commercially utilized acquisition strategy" means an acquisition of a service by the head of an agency under terms and conditions that—
(A) are similar to the terms and conditions under which such service is available to the public; and
(B) provide such service—
(i) as a consumption-based solution (as defined in section 3605 of this title); or
(ii) under a technology subscription model or other model based on predetermined pricing for access to such service.
(2) The term "covered service" means a commercial service that includes access to or use of any combination of hardware, equipment, software, labor, or services, including access to commercial satellite data and associated services, that is integrated to provide a capability.
Editorial Notes
Codification
The text of subsec. (f) of section 2307 of this title, which was transferred to this section and amended by Pub. L. 116–283, §1834(f), was based on Pub. L. 103–355, title II, §2001(f), Oct. 13, 1994, 108 Stat. 3302; Pub. L. 115–232, div. A, title VIII, §836(c)(6), Aug. 13, 2018, 132 Stat. 1866.
Amendments
2025—Subsec. (d). Pub. L. 119–60, §1827(1), designated existing provisions as par. (1) and added par. (2).
Subsec. (e). Pub. L. 119–60, §1827(2), added subsec. (e).
2021—Pub. L. 116–283, §1834(f)(1)(A), transferred subsec. (f) of section 2307 of this title to this section and struck out subsec. (f) designation and heading "Conditions for Payments for Commercial Products and Commercial Services" at beginning.
Subsec. (a). Pub. L. 116–283, §1834(f)(1)(B), (4), after transfer of section 2307(f) of this title to this section, redesignated par. (1) as subsec. (a), inserted heading, and substituted "section 3801 of this title" for "subsection (a)".
Subsec. (b). Pub. L. 116–283, §1834(f)(4), inserted heading.
Pub. L. 116–283, §1834(f)(2), which directed the designation of "the second sentence of subsection (a) as subsection (b)", was executed by designating the second and third sentences of subsec. (a) as (b), to reflect the probable intent of Congress.
Subsec. (c). Pub. L. 116–283, §1834(f)(1)(B), (5), after transfer of section 2307(f) of this title to this section, redesignated par. (2) as subsec. (c), inserted heading, and substituted "section 3801 of this title" for "subsection (a)".
Subsec. (d). Pub. L. 116–283, §1834(f)(1)(B), (6), after transfer of section 2307(f) of this title to this section, redesignated par. (3) as subsec. (d), inserted heading, and substituted "sections 3803 and 3804 of this title" for "subsections (d) and (e)" and "this section" for "paragraphs (1) and (2)".
